ive got a 92 XJ, 9" of lift, AW4, 4.6/4.7 stroker will be done by feb, D30/44 with 4.56's, and x-terrain 35's

im looking at the front axle and tryin to figure out what i want to do. as soon as my 35's are done i would like to run 38 SX's. so pretty much the 30 needs to be swapped but i dont know if a 44 is what i should be looking at or if i should go with more beef. i was thinking of just a waggy 44 front and just getting adapters for the rear 44, but im not sure if that will be a good route or not.

so far all that i wheel is trails, mud, snow. havent touched any type of rock crawling or anything super extreme yet because the rig is still my DD.

Benzz0
12-19-2005, 08:34 AM
anything larger than 36's on a 44's is asking for broken parts...TSL/SX's are HEAVY and WILL break stock 44 Ujoints...you do not have to be doing something extreme to break a Ujoint - I broke two in my back woods on 38 TSL's just playing in the creek!

if you add up the cost for beefying up 44's with chromoly shafts, front CTM/300 Ujoints and nice hubs - you could pick up stock D60 F/R cheaper
